pg 日期和时间的运算操作
4、日期和时间的运算操作:
日期和时间可以有:加、减、乘、除的运算操作。
例子:指定日期加运算:+10日后的日期
testdb=# select date '2018-08-15' + integer '10';
?column?
------------
2018-08-25
(1 row)
例子:指定日期加上间隔小时,+3小时
testdb=# select date '2018-08-15' + interval '3 hour';
?column?
---------------------
2018-08-15 03:00:00
(1 row)
例子:指定日期加上指定时间后的结果,如:
testdb=# select date '2018-08-15' + time '06:00';
?column?
---------------------
2018-08-15 06:00:00
(1 row)
例子:指定日期和时间加上间隔时间后的结果:
testdb=# select timestamp '2018-08-15 02:00:00' + interval '10 hours';
?column?
---------------------
2018-08-15 12:00:00
(1 row)
例子:指定日期之间的间隔天数,如:
testdb=# select date '2018-08-15' - date '2018-07-10';
?column?
----------
36
(1 row)
例子:指定日期减去间隔天数后的结果,如:
testdb=# select date '2018-08-15' - integer '10';
?column?
------------
2018-08-05
(1 row)
例子:计算整数与天数相乘的结果,如:
testdb=# select 15 * interval '2 day';
?column?
----------
30 days
(1 row)
例子:计算整数与秒数相乘的结果,如:
testdb=# select 50 * interval '2 second';
?column?
----------
00:01:40
(1 row)
例子:计算小时数与整数相乘的结果,如:
testdb=# select interval '1 hour' / integer '2';
?column?
----------
00:30:00
(1 row)
pg 日期和时间的运算操作相关推荐
- db2数据库日期减一天_DB2 数据库中的日期与时间如何正确操作?(2)
日期函数 有时,您需要知道两个时间戳记之间的时差.为此,DB2 数据库提供了一个名为 TIMESTAMPDIFF() 的内置函数.但该函数返回的是近似值,因为它不考虑闰年,而且假设每个月只有 30 天 ...
- QT教程3: 日期和时间的对象操作
一 说明 在这篇文章中,我将向您展示如何在 PyQt5 中创建 QDate 和 QTime QDate 是用于处理公历中日历日期的类 它具有确定日期.比较或操作日期的方法. QTime 类使用时钟时间 ...
- android 传输日期,Android 跟日期和时间有关的操作
1用Data还是用Calendar 看Data源码,一开头就说了Data有bug,具体是啥bug我也看不太懂不用关心,反正官方推荐用Calendar. 2SimpleDateFormat Simple ...
- android 录入日期,Android 跟日期和时间有关的操作
1用Data还是用Calendar 看Data源码,一开头就说了Data有bug,具体是啥bug我也看不太懂不用关心,反正官方推荐用Calendar. 2SimpleDateFormat Simple ...
- java 日期和时间_java 日期与时间操作
我们先来了解一下基本的概念 日期 2020-11-21 2020-11-22 时间 15:36:43 2020-11-21 15:36:43 时区 北京时间 2020-11-21 15:36:43 东 ...
- 详解java中的日期与时间;新旧API对比;各种日期格式转换
一.基本概念 1.本地时间 不同的时区,在同一时刻,本地时间是不同的. 全球一共分为24个时区,伦敦所在的时区称为标准时区,其他时区按东/西偏移的小时区分,北京所在的时区是东八区. 2.时区 GMT ...
- mysql 日期_「5」学习MySQL日期与时间类型发现:要养成注重细节的习惯
在前面的学习中我们提到过字段类型这个概念,本篇的主题就是来讲一种常用而相对复杂的类型:日期与时间. MySQL中表示日期与时间的数据类型有很多种,但主要的不外乎下面五种: 记住上面表中的"范 ...
- LocalDateTime - Java处理日期和时间
java.time包提供了新的日期和时间的API,新的API主要包括:1. LocalDate/LocalTime/LocalDateTime2. ZoneDateTime/ZoneId3. Inst ...
- java8日期转时间戳_Java 8日期和时间
java8日期转时间戳 如今,一些应用程序仍在使用java.util.Date和java.util.Calendar API,包括使我们的生活更轻松地使用这些类型的库,例如JodaTime. 但是,J ...
最新文章
- 英特尔AI芯片首次商用交货!推理性能3.7倍于英伟达T4,年贡献245亿涨250%
- 【探索】Web新概念——资料横向显示(欢迎点评)
- numpy中的ndim、shape、dtype、astype
- boost::spirit模块演示语法和语义操作的计算器示例
- Attention!神经网络中的注意机制到底是什么?
- python自学看什么书-python自学看什么书
- 懒惰是人类进步的动力,勤奋是实现偷懒的途径
- button执行onclick函数_JavaScript 函数定义与调用
- mac monterey、big sur、Catalina原生heic、jpg壁纸,并将壁纸拷贝到系统文件夹下教程
- dsp gpip操作 data set 和clc
- c语言如何使用floor函数,floor函数 Excel中floor函数怎么使用
- 基于SpringBoot的车辆调度系统的设计与实现
- QTreeWidget去掉虚线框
- RTSP安防网络摄像头/海康大华硬盘录像机网页无插件直播方案EasyNVR出现操作和画面显示不一致问题如何优化?
- RtspLiveServer一款支持rtsp协议流媒体服务器软件
- mysql创建触发器
- 51单片机入学第一课———点亮自己的LED灯珠
- Java实现数据库jdbc连接测试
- 记录使用WIN10自带的恢复功能,还原系统
- 什么是社群运营?如何将营销小程序与社群运营相结合?
热门文章
- 选择在何处重构(下)
- C#中的通用循环缓冲区
- Ubuntu 发布迁移手册,拉拢 Windows 7 用户
- GaussDB(openGauss)宣布开源,性能超越 MySQL 与 PostgreSQL
- 从零开始实现ASP.NET Core MVC的插件式开发(一) - 使用ApplicationPart动态加载控制器和视图
- 实现机器学习的循序渐进指南V——支持向量机
- 一点排位就安全异常退出_吃鸡战场排位连跪最好的处理方式并不是继续排位,大神一般这样做!...
- 如何访问云端的tcpserver_Swoole: TcpServer+SocketServer+EMQTT组合,实现基础设备控制
- java 获取js html_JS获取网页中HTML元素的几种方法
- 需要用sq语句 修改大批量用户的密码_网站文章seo优化及修改已收录文章建议